In 2024, Haiti faced an unprecedented humanitarian crisis, characterized by escalating gang violence, massive population displacement, and climate disasters. Over one million people were displaced, mainly women and children, seeking refuge in overcrowded displacement sites. These conditions exacerbate the vulnerabilities of women and girls, making them even more susceptible to gender-based violence (GBV) and risks to their sexual and reproductive health.
